Whose data are you using to decide which coin to mine?

Don't understand why you are touching DOGE with the reward being reduced to 12500

Hope you arent using COinchoose API as their site is so in accurate

The difficulty dropped sharply after the reward was reduced, because multipools wouldn't touch it til it dropped lower.  The halving had very little effect on profitability, though that is why we've been hitting LTC more often (less time spent on DOGE because the diff goes up fast once it drops low enough for multipools to hit it).

Great thanks for the explanation!

No problem.  It's something very common with coins who have abstract reward days or frequent halvings.  Since people aren't locked into mining a specific coin with their hardware, they'll simply mine something else after a reward change.  Eventually the difficulty will end up being (roughly) half of what it would have been previously.  A good example of this is Earthcoin, which has 2x and 5x reward periods.  During this time, the difficulty basically increases to 2x or 5x what it normally is, so for profitability it is virtually the same as any other day.

It's not an exact halving of difficulty since Doge has a decent number of loyal miners, but with multipools being such a huge part of the average DOGE hashing rate, the difficulty still dropped significantly so that it's still worth mining as a multipool, just not for quite as long as it normally would be.
